At present, the residential building energy efficiency design standards set forth in theexisting buildings need energy-saving target of65%, while the rate of about45%share ofenergy-saving building envelope, thus improving the building envelope insulationperformance is particularly critical for reducing building energy consumption. At this stage,the energy-saving transformation of the existing structure has become an important part ofcivil engineering, but the problem that buildings still reliable enough during the subsequentuse of energy saving is not taken seriously enough. In the process of energy-savingtransformation of the existing building, making the overall weight of structure increase,changing the internal force and deformation of structure, the overall seismic performance ofthe existing structure is Adverse and the reliability of the building will be reduced or evenresult in serious consequences. Therefore, it is necessary to estimate the reliability of theexisting structure before the energy-saving transformation.In this paper, taking an8-layer frame-shear wall structure as example, systematicallystudy on the estimates of the reliability of existing buildings after the energy-savingtransformation, and research from the following aspects. First of all, introduce the basicconcepts of reliability and calculation method of the center-point method design point methodabout structural components’ reliability, consider the load model of the existing buildingstructure and the random process model of resistance decay over time, determine thecombination of load effects, give formula for the cross-section bearing capacity of the varioustypes of elements (beams, columns, shear walls), and use practical First Order SecondMoment to calculate the reliability of the existing structural components. Second, calculate areliable indicator of the floor by load/resistance ratio and weight coefficients of eachcomponent in the same layer, then according to the mutual relations between the layers todetermine a reliable indicator of the existing building structures. The last, analysis the8-layerframe-shear wall structure of energy-saving example for structural system reliability, and useit as reference, according to a reliable indicator of structural bearing capacity limit andstructural identification of the conclusions to determine whether the building forenergy-saving transformation.
